Icicle Castle
These massive structures begin construction by artisans in fall. It starts with a little over 10,000 icicles, which are made by dripping water off strings.  Once they have reached about 3 feet in length (0.9 m) all of the icicles are plucked and put into position. They then begin to spray and drip water on the structures overnight. It’s an elaborate process, which takes countless man hours and engineering knowledge.

Ice Tunnel
The result is a 25,000 million lbs (11.3 kg) castle. Complete with slides, tunnels, domes, fountains, thrones, and spires. This attraction drives thousands of visitors each year to Dillon.
